Plus-sized women shouldn't think of themselves as a size. They should think of themselves as women with rich goals in life. Size doesn't mean, really, anything. You can carry your size with pride and dress in a way that you like.
Donatella Versace

Interpretation

What this quote means

This quote emphasizes that self-worth is not tied to size but rather to personal goals and self-acceptance.

Donatella Versace's quote encourages plus-sized women to focus on their ambitions and goals rather than their physical size. It promotes an empowering view that individuals should celebrate their bodies, regardless of societal standards, and wear what makes them feel confident and proud. By redefining how one views size, the quote inspires self-acceptance and self-love.
